Hi Peeps. I need to buy a weed fin and I'm confused by size. Is it true I need to buy a weed fin that's several inches shorter than my standard slalom fin? I assume this is because of the rake measurement from tip to base?

My new 115ltr Tabou Rocket came with a 42" slalom fin. I'll be using sails from 5-7m on it and I weigh in at around 86 kegs hungry. What size weedy should I be looking at buying if I only buy one size (for the moment)?

I use to use a 40cm weedfin on an 80 cm wide slalom board with an 8 m sail, regular slalom fin was 48cm. 42 cm weed on a 115 L freeride board is going to be huge, and not work very well. I am using a 23 on a fsw 110 up to 6m and a 28 for 7-7.5 with inboard footstraps. The 28 i also used with a 7m slalom sail on a 105 rocket 61 wide. On the rocket you would need a some more fin. I think 32-36 would be good on the rocket from 6-7m, but definately not 42...

Just as a rough guide I use the following weedies:
Falcon 125 79 wide with 7.8 = 36cm
Falcon 112 69 wide with 7.0 to 7.8 = 32cm
Falcon 99 63 wide with 6.4 to 7.0 = 25cm Be aware thus combo is usually sailed in pretty flat water and shallow too.
Falcon 79 56 wide with 5.8 to 6.4 = 19cm Same as above.
Like a lot of guys these days I have cut down fins, made them have more rake and re-foiled etc.
You can get away with smaller fins, just ask Keef
There are heaps of brands out there, also look at Black Project, Maui Ultra, JP, Flying Objects.

Normally the size of a weed fin indicates it's depth, not length, so a 36 weed fin would be longer than 36, the longer the higher the rake. Also checked my weed fins and what I said before is wrong, you can use a weed fin with less depth than your slalom one...
One more thing no one has mentioned is that the first time it will feel hard to sail with a weed fin: harder to go upwind, more prone to spin out and uncomfortable stance.

on Patrik 115 (69 wide) i usually use a 42 slalom or will use a 36 weedy if in botany and a 24 Delta for lake illawarra.

On JP 59 wide slalom i use a 34 slalom for normal , 28 Flying object speed weed (lake george) and a 18 Delta for lake illawarra.

Depends on depth / amount of weed and chop you sailing in.

Used 7.0 TRX on all these combos.
